Arteries are muscular, elastic vessels that supply oxygenated blood from the heart to the body's tissues. They are designed to withstand high blood pressure and deliver blood to the farthest reaches of the body. Arteries branch off into smaller arterioles, which further divide into tiny capillaries that exchange oxygen and nutrients with cells.

Veins, on the other hand, are thinner, more flexible vessels that return deoxygenated blood from the body's tissues back to the heart. They have one-way valves that prevent backflow and ensure blood flows smoothly back to the heart. How do arteries and veins work?

Arteries and veins are two types of blood vessels that work together to circulate blood throughout the body. Arteries are responsible for carrying oxygenated blood away from the heart to the rest of the body, while veins return deoxygenated blood back to the heart. In simple terms, arteries are like the highways that deliver oxygen and nutrients to cells, while veins are the return roads that collect waste and deoxygenated blood.
